Top Mental Performance and Visualization Apps for Golfers

A curated selection of digital tools designed to enhance golf performance through psychological training, vivid visualization, and focus improvement. These applications help players master the mental game by offering guided meditations, pre-shot routine builders, and immersive visualization exercises tailored to the unique demands of the sport.
